Skip to content

Commit ebb5c10

Browse files
committed
Merge branch 'main' of github.com:coderflexx/laravel-presenter into main
2 parents 8712e9f + 343817c commit ebb5c10

File tree

6 files changed

+18
-12
lines changed

6 files changed

+18
-12
lines changed

src/Concerns/CanPresent.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,4 +11,4 @@ interface CanPresent
1111
* @return mixed
1212
*/
1313
public function present(string $type = 'default');
14-
}
14+
}

tests/Models/Post.php

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,8 @@
11
<?php
22

3-
namespace Coderflex\LaravelPresenter\Tests\Models;;
3+
namespace Coderflex\LaravelPresenter\Tests\Models;
4+
5+
;
46

57
use Coderflex\LaravelPresenter\Concerns\UsesPresenters;
68
use Coderflex\LaravelPresenter\Tests\Presenters\PostPresenter;

tests/Models/User.php

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,8 @@
11
<?php
22

3-
namespace Coderflex\LaravelPresenter\Tests\Models;;
3+
namespace Coderflex\LaravelPresenter\Tests\Models;
4+
5+
;
46

57
use Coderflex\LaravelPresenter\Concerns\CanPresent;
68
use Coderflex\LaravelPresenter\Concerns\UsesPresenters;
@@ -16,4 +18,4 @@ class User extends Model implements CanPresent
1618
protected $presenters = [
1719
'default' => UserPresenter::class,
1820
];
19-
}
21+
}

tests/Presenters/PostPresenter.php

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,11 @@
11
<?php
22

3-
namespace Coderflex\LaravelPresenter\Tests\Presenters;;
3+
namespace Coderflex\LaravelPresenter\Tests\Presenters;
4+
5+
;
46

5-
use Illuminate\Support\Str;
67
use Coderflex\LaravelPresenter\Presenter;
8+
use Illuminate\Support\Str;
79

810
class PostPresenter extends Presenter
911
{

tests/Presenters/UserPresenter.php

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,8 @@
11
<?php
22

3-
namespace Coderflex\LaravelPresenter\Tests\Presenters;;
3+
namespace Coderflex\LaravelPresenter\Tests\Presenters;
4+
5+
;
46

57
use Coderflex\LaravelPresenter\Presenter;
68

tests/PresentersTest.php

Lines changed: 3 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
$this->artisan('presenter:make ')
88
->assertExitCode(1);
99
})->throws(
10-
Symfony\Component\Console\Exception\RuntimeException::class,
10+
Symfony\Component\Console\Exception\RuntimeException::class,
1111
'Not enough arguments (missing: "name").'
1212
)->group('Presenter Command');
1313

@@ -21,7 +21,7 @@
2121
'first_name' => 'John',
2222
'last_name' => 'Doe',
2323
'email' => '[email protected]',
24-
'password' => '123'
24+
'password' => '123',
2525
]);
2626

2727
expect($user->present()->fullName)
@@ -30,13 +30,11 @@
3030

3131
it('should implements CanPresent Interface', function () {
3232
$post = new Post([
33-
'title' => 'a title for a post'
33+
'title' => 'a title for a post',
3434
]);
3535

3636
$post->present()->slug;
3737
})->throws(
3838
Coderflex\LaravelPresenter\Exceptions\PresenterException::class,
3939
'Coderflex\LaravelPresenter\Tests\Models\Post should implements \Coderflex\LaravelPresenter\Concerns\CanPresent interface'
4040
)->group('Presenter Implementation');
41-
42-

0 commit comments

Comments
 (0)